Heart drug study halted early: did painkiller weaken blood thinner?
NCT ID NCT03476369
First seen Feb 04, 2026 · Last updated May 23, 2026 · Updated 20 times
Summary
This study tested whether the painkiller fentanyl reduces the effectiveness of the blood thinner ticagrelor in people getting a heart stent. It included 45 adults undergoing a stent procedure. The study was stopped early, so results are limited.
